How much do remote recruiter j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ote recruiter in Worcester, MA is $27.61,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$21.59 and $33.08 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a remote recruiter?

A Remote Recruiter is a professional who manages the recruitment and hiring process for organizations entirely from a remote location, often working from home or another non-office setting. Their responsibilities include sourcing candidates, conducting interviews, coordinating with hiring managers, and guiding applicants through the hiring process—all using digital communication tools. Remote Recruiters typically use video calls, emails, and online platforms to connect with candidates and employers, making them essential for companies with distributed or global teams.

What does a remote recruiter do?

A remote recruiter finds qualified candidates to fill job openings for their clients. Unlike recruiters that work in the office, remote recruiters often work from home. Your responsibilities include meeting with clients to discuss their hiring needs and obtain a list of qualifications and duties for the role. You search job boards, social media networks, and other relevant sites to identify job seekers that meet the criteria preferred by your client. Most remote recruiters perform an initial screening with the candidate on the phone and then may meet in person before forwarding the job seeker's information on to the hiring supervisor at the company. Remote recruiters are usually paid a commission if their client hires the candidate they found.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ote recruiter?

To thrive as a Remote Recruiter, you need a solid understanding of talent acquisition strategies, candidate sourcing, and interview techniques, typically supported by experience in HR or recruiting. Familiarity with applicant tracking systems (ATS), recruiting platforms like LinkedIn, and video interviewing tools is essential. Strong communication, organization, and self-motivation are crucial soft skills for building relationships and managing processes independently. These skills enable recruiters to efficiently source top talent and ensure a smooth hiring process in a virtual environment.

What are some common challenges faced by remote recruiters, and how can they be addressed?

Remote recruiters often face challenges such as building rapport with candidates virtually, coordinating across different time zones, and maintaining clear communication with hiring managers. To address these challenges, leveraging video conferencing tools for more personal interactions, using scheduling apps to accommodate time differences, and establishing regular check-ins with the hiring team are effective strategies. Additionally, utilizing collaborative software for tracking candidates and sharing feedback can help ensure a smooth, transparent recruitment process.

What is the difference between Remote Recruiter vs Remote HR Coordinator?

AspectRemote RecruiterRemote HR Coordinator
CredentialsRecruitment certifications, HR knowledgeHR certifications, employee relations experience
Work EnvironmentFocus on sourcing and hiring candidates remotelyHandle employee onboarding, records, and communication remotely
Employer & Industry UsageUsed across industries for hiring rolesUsed in HR departments for employee management
Search & Comparison IntentCompare roles related to hiring and recruitmentCompare roles related to employee management and HR functions

Remote Recruiters primarily focus on sourcing, interviewing, and hiring candidates remotely, requiring recruitment-specific skills and certifications. Remote HR Coordinators handle employee onboarding, records, and HR processes from a distance, often needing HR certifications. While both roles operate remotely and within HR functions, their core responsibilities differ, making this comparison useful for those exploring careers or hiring options in remote HR roles.
